Posted by Anita Schorsch on Nov 29, 2013 in | Comments Off on Mourning Becomes America The Pennsylvania Historical and Museum Commission will sponsor a Bicentennial exhibit of mourning art beginning with the art of the fashionable people in the late eighteenth century and concluding with the naive expressions in watercolor, paper, and silhouette in the midÂ-nineteenth century. The exhibit opens March 28 [1976] at the William Penn Memorial Museum and will continue through May 27...read more
